πŸ…² C — Craft Choice & Career Direction 🎨

Not all crafts should be mixed at the start.

Choose:

  • ONE core skill (beadwork / wire / sewing / upholstery / recycling)
  • ONE product category (jewellery / dΓ©cor / fashion / accessories)

πŸ“Œ Focus allows:

  • Faster mastery
  • Better pricing
  • Stronger brand identity

🎯 Outcome:
Clear craft identity & production focus.

πŸ…΄ E — Experimentation & Product Development πŸ§ͺ

This is the research phase of your business.

Experiment with:

  • Colours 🎨
  • Sizes πŸ“
  • Materials
  • Cultural vs modern designs

Test:

  • What sells fast?
  • What is expensive to produce?
  • What customers repeat-buy?

πŸ“Š Outcome:
Data-informed product selection.

πŸ…Ί K — Knowledge of Costing & Pricing πŸ’ΈπŸ“Š

Pricing is survival.

Know:

  • Material cost
  • Labour time
  • Overheads
  • Profit margin

🚫 Underpricing = burnout
✅ Fair pricing = sustainability

πŸ“Œ Outcome:
Profitable business.

πŸ…Ό M — Market Mapping & Targeting πŸ—Ί️πŸ›️

Different markets want different products.

Markets include:

  • Craft markets
  • Galleries
  • Boutiques
  • Cultural events
  • Online platforms
  • Tourists
  • Corporate gifting

πŸ“Œ Outcome:
Right product in the right place.
